To outsiders, St Patrick’s High School in Johannesburg is a model of excellence, producing well-balanced young adults equipped to claim their inheritance as the new leaders of the fledgling democracy. But behind this facade lies a dark secret: the school is dominated by ‘The Club’, a powerful group of senior students who have adopted the values of the business and political elite of a post-Mandela South Africa. Bright, privileged and utterly ruthless, they manipulate the school for their own gain, their antics invisible behind the polished exterior of the exclusive institution.
